Illustrate and explain the calculation by using equations, rectangular arrays, and/or area models. Web19 dec. 2024 · Example 1: Find the remainder of 15 x 17 x 19 when divided by 7. Solution: On dividing 15 by 7 we get 1 as remainder. On dividing 17 by 7 we get 3 as remainder. On dividing 19 by 7 we get 5 as remainder. Remainder of the expression (15 x 17 x 19)/7 will be equal to (1 x 3 x 5)/7. Combined remainder will be equal to remainder of 15/7 i.e. 1.
